9L, SIERRA LEONE. Just a reminder that the members of the VooDoo Contest
Group will be active during CQWW DX CW Contest (November 28-29th), signing
9L5A. This year the operators are Ned/AA7A, Nick/G3RWF, Fred/G4BWP,
Bud/N7CW and Gary/ZL2IFB. They will enter the contest as a Multi-Two
entry. Their activity in the contest will be on all six contest bands.
For pre-contest activity, there may also be some operations on 30/17/12
meter bands and RTTY. QSL 9L5A via G3SXW (see QRZ.com). G3RWF may also
activate his 9L1NH callsign, and AA7A his 9L7NS callsign. Please QSL via
their home callsigns. There will be no daily logs, but LoTW upload will
be done soon after returning home. No cash donations are requested for
this project just the usual USD/IRC for direct cards.

CR5, PORTUGAL. Operators Marq/CT1BWW, Zoli/HA1AG and Con/DF4SA will be
active as CR5X in the CQWW DX CW Contest (November 28-29th) as a Multi-
Single entry. They will have two fully equipped stations using 2 Spider-
beam Yagis on 40-10m, and wire verticals on 40/80/160m using their 12m,
18m, and (for the first time) 26m fiberglass poles. This will be a
temporary setup; an installation will start 40 hours before the contest.
QSL via DJ9MH. They will confirm all QSOs automatically via the Bureau.

H40, TEMOTU PROVINCE. Operators Siegfried/DK9FN, Bernhard/DL2GAC and
Hans-Peter/DG1FK will be active as H40FN (CW), H40MS (SSB) and H40FK
(Digi-mode), respectively, from Ngarando/Reef Islands (OC-065) between
February 6–19th (2010). Activity will be focused on 160/80m (using their
famous LOBSTER 2-element multi-band vertical), but they will operate on
160-6 meters depending on the band conditions. QSL H40FN via HA8FW, H40MS
via DL2GAC and H40FK via DG1FK. QSL cards will be sent out automatically
via the Bureau. However, for those who want to receive their QSL cards
directly, a minimum of 2 USDs for postage is requested. Donations are
most welcome. For more details, updates and pictures/details of Siegfried's

IOTA NEWS....................
   AS-127.  (Update/Rare IOTA) Last week we reported that operators Tutul/
            S21RC, Manjurul/S21AM, Sohel/S21S and Aminul/S21D were preparing
            a DXpedition in February 2010 to St. Martin's Island located
            in Chittagong Region Group. The operation will take place
            between February 21-25th. The group has requested the callsign
            S21DX. St. Martin is the only coral island in Bangladesh (S2),
            and there is also a lighthouse on the Island (WLOTA #2351)
            very near their camp site. There is no electricity and no motor
            vehicles on the Island which makes the air interference free.
            They team plans to have two stations on the air with a few
            antennas like last time. To power the stations they will use
            1KVA generator and 2x 115AH batteries. QSL Manager will be
            EB7DX. The group is looking for sponsors/funds. A Web page
            is now up and running at:        http://iota.s2dx.org

IRC REMINDER! Alan, VK4AAR, and many other QSL Managers would like to
remind that in about 5 weeks time, the IRCs which many have been using
for the last few years will no longer be valid at the post office. The
"31st December 2009" is the deadline for the current style ... but best
to stop using them by end of November to allow transit time. The new
one has the expiry date of "31st December 2013"... just above the "UPU"
logo at your right-hand side. PLEASE START USING THEM IMMEDIATELY FOR
SAFETY.

IU9, ITALY. Fabio, IT9GSF, will be active as IU9T from Sicily during the
CQWW DX CW Contest (November 28-29th) as a Single-Op/All-Band entry.
QSL via IT9GSF. He states this is a serious attempt as SO2R (Single-Op/
2-Radios). Fabio will have yagis on 4 bands, a vertical on 80m and a
an Inverted L on 160m at 21m. He will use beverages for RX. He adds,
"Extremely good location for USA and Asia on the low bands (800m asl
and slope terrain)."

KH6BZF PROPAGATION FORECAST/REPORT (For November 30th-December 6th)....
  Nov  30    AN         SOLAR REFERENCE
  Dec   1    AN         ---------------
  Dec   2    AN          AN - Above Normal/Geomagnetic Level is QUIET
  Dec   3    AN          HN - High Normal/Geomagnetic Level is UNSETTLED
  Dec   4    AN          LN - Low Normal
  Dec   5    AN
  Dec   6    AN         GEOMAGNETIC REFERENCE
                        ---------------------
                         QUIET - The "A" index is expected to be between
                                 0-7 and the "K" index will be 2 or less
                     UNSETTLED - The "A" index is expected to be between
                                 7-16 and "K" index will be 3 or less

SOUTH AMERICAN TOUR. Ghis, ON5NT, will once again be on a South American
trip through Brazil and Uruguay in December. He informs OPDX that there
will not be any activity from Brazil as there is no reciprocal license
between ON and PY (He states, "I can't get a PY license. Operating with
my CEPT license/PY does not seem to be fully legal."). However, Ghis
will be active from Uruguay between December 12-17th. His callsign will
be CX5NT. As this is holiday trip, he plans to be active mostly during
the local evening/night hours. So check 30m (10107 being his preferred
frequency) and 40m (CW in general) will be the best options to catch
him. QSL via ON5NT.
